BNSF Seeks Approval for Extended Haul Trains Beyond Limit.
BNSF Railway has petitioned the Federal Railroad Administration (FRA) for an extension of a waiver compliance from certain provisions of the Federal railroad safety regulations to continue operating extended haul trains for distances of up to 1,702 miles, beyond the limit of 1,500 miles stated in the regulation. BNSF states that operations under this waiver have reduced risk exposure for personal injuries and improved upon crew rest, resulting in noise reduction and reduced pollutants. Interested parties are invited to participate in these proceedings by submitting written views, data, or comments.
